PepsiCo is looking to drive software development activities and long-term initiative planning and collaboration across the Strategy & Transformation (S&T) organization to deliver scalable digital transformation.
Requirements
- Minimum of 10 years of relevant software development and engineering management experience
- 10+ years of experience on architecting fault tolerant, high scale distributed systems
- 8+ years of experience in mobile development, with at least 4 years in a leadership/managerial role
- Strong expertise in React Native, along with native iOS and Android development experience
- Experience leading cross-functional teams in an agile/scrum environment
- Solid understanding of mobile app architecture, performance tuning, and security best practices
- Commanding knowledge of data structures, algorithms, and object-oriented design
Responsibilities
- Create the vision and guide a team of engineers to build and support digital products and applications (DPA) across S&T core priorities.
- Drive partnerships with User Experience, Product Management, IT, Data & Analytics, Emerging Tech, Innovation, and Process Engineering teams to deliver the Digital Products portfolio.
- Develop software development strategy utilizing industry standards. Create roadmap and timing of implementation of the roadmap based on business requirements and strategy.
- Lead multi-discipline, high-performance work teams distributed across remote locations effectively. Build, manage, develop, and mentor a team of engineers.
- Develop and expand DPA capabilities through a customer obsessed, services-driven digital solutions platform that leverages data and AI to deliver automated and personalized experiences.
- Manage and appropriately escalate delivery impediments, risks, issues, and changes tied to the engineering initiatives to the stakeholders.
- Interact with key business partners to recommend solutions that best meet the strategic needs of the business.
Other
- Interact with executives across the company to lead the narrative around software engineering.
- Excellent communication and leadership skills, with the ability to align technical execution with business goals
- Bachelor's or Master's degree in Computer Science, Engineering, or related field
- Demonstrated ability to ship high-quality consumer or enterprise apps at scale
- Experience with Salesforce CG cloud preferred